Try Catch Exception Error Code


If an exception is thrown, the statements in the finally clause execute even if no catch clause handles the exception. C# Copy catch (InvalidCastException e) { if (e.Data == null) { throw; } else { // Take some action. } } From inside a try block, initialize only variables that are The with statement allows objects like files to be used in a way that ensures they are always cleaned up promptly and correctly. If I always return null in case of the exception it will work. http://u2commerce.com/error-code/try-catch-exception-error-number.html

For example, a TRY…CATCH construct cannot span two BEGIN…END blocks of Transact-SQL statements and cannot span an IF…ELSE construct.If there are no errors in the code that is enclosed in a Modern browsers will often use a combination of JavaScript and built-in HTML validation, using predefined validation rules defined in HTML attributes: try statement works as follows. Reply hfrmobile Member 3 Points 11 Posts Re: How catch exception codes / error code in C# Mar 19, 2010 10:33 AM|hfrmobile|LINK I'd like to catch only SqlException with a specific http://stackoverflow.com/questions/6893165/how-to-get-exception-error-code-in-c-sharp

Get Error Code From Exception C#

A TRY…CATCH construct cannot span multiple blocks of Transact-SQL statements. If the exception is not one of the specified exceptions and an unconditional catch clause is found, control transfers to that catch clause. Please "Mark as Answer" if it's useful for you. SET XACT_ABORT ON; BEGIN TRY BEGIN TRANSACTION; -- A FOREIGN KEY constraint exists on this table.

except Exception as inst: ... Following the try block is a catch block that catches any exception that results from the try block.Example C#C++VB Copy using System; using System.IO; public class ProcessFile { public static void An uncommittable transaction can only perform read operations or a ROLLBACK TRANSACTION. Get Hresult From Exception C# For suggestions on when to set code in a try block, see Best Practices for Handling Exceptions.The following code example uses a try/catch block to catch a possible exception.

Copy BEGIN TRY -- Generate a divide-by-zero error. C# Exception Hresult except ZeroDivisionError as detail: ... print "result is", result ... Is it unethical of me and can I get in trouble if a professor passes me based on an oral exam without attending class?

SELECT 1/0; END TRY BEGIN CATCH SELECT ERROR_NUMBER() AS ErrorNumber ,ERROR_SEVERITY() AS ErrorSeverity ,ERROR_STATE() AS ErrorState ,ERROR_PROCEDURE() AS ErrorProcedure ,ERROR_MESSAGE() AS ErrorMessage; END CATCH; GO See AlsoTHROW (Transact-SQL)Database Engine Error SeveritiesERROR_LINE Try Catch C# That is, there are three forms of the try statement: try...catch try...finally try...catch...finally A catch clause contain statements that specify what to do if an exception is thrown in the try Goodbye, world! Returning from a finally block If the finally block returns a value, this value becomes the return value of the entire try-catch-finally production, regardless of any return statements in the try

C# Exception Hresult

return repr(self.value) ... >>> try: ... https://docs.python.org/2.7/tutorial/errors.html Implemented in JavaScript 1.4 ECMAScript 5.1 (ECMA-262)The definition of 'try statement' in that specification. Get Error Code From Exception C# current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. Exception Error Code Java Every polynomial with real coefficients is the sum of cubes of three polynomials Output a googol copies of a string Disproving Euler proposition by brute force in C Can I image

The block is executed until an exception is thrown or it is completed successfully. this content try { ProcessString(s); } catch (Exception e) { Console.WriteLine("{0} Exception caught.", e); } } } /* Output: System.ArgumentNullException: Value cannot be null. The TypeError raised by dividing two strings is not handled by the except clause and therefore re-raised after the finally clause has been executed. Awaiting a canceled task throws an OperationCanceledException. C# Error Code List

More information on classes is presented in chapter Classes. 8.6. All Rights Reserved. throw new YourCustomException("Put your error message here.", e); } You can also re-throw an exception when a specified condition is true, as shown in the following example. http://u2commerce.com/error-code/tsm-error-code-50.html Handlers only handle exceptions that occur in the corresponding try clause, not in other handlers of the same try statement.

except (RuntimeError, TypeError, NameError): ... C# Exception Error Code List In real world applications, the finally clause is useful for releasing external resources (such as files or network connections), regardless of whether the use of the resource was successful. 8.7. This identifier is local to the catch clause.

You can also use one or more conditional catch clauses to handle specific exceptions.

Examples might be simplified to improve reading and basic understanding. In general, you should only catch those exceptions that you know how to recover from. finally: ... C# Try Catch Finally For example: >>> try: ...

executing finally clause >>> divide("2", "1") executing finally clause Traceback (most recent call last): File "", line 1, in File "", line 3, in divide TypeError: unsupported operand type(s) for Do you have any idea? Handling run-time error: integer division or modulo by zero 8.4. http://u2commerce.com/error-code/tsm-error-code-418.html See the JavaScript Guide for more information on JavaScript exceptions.

You’ll be auto redirected in 1 second. Now I'm work with C#, but don't see a reason that could make here a difference. –Hi-Angel Oct 3 '14 at 15:26 add a comment| 3 Answers 3 active oldest votes The following example extracts source information from an IOException exception, and then throws the exception to the parent method. w3schools.com THE WORLD'S LARGEST WEB DEVELOPER SITE ☰ HTML CSS JAVASCRIPT SQL PHP BOOTSTRAP JQUERY ANGULAR XML   TUTORIALS REFERENCES EXAMPLES FORUM × HTML and CSS Learn HTML Learn CSS

except MyError as e: ... raise NameError('HiThere') ... The throw statement lets you create custom errors. To catch an exception that an async task throws, place the await expression in a try block, and catch the exception in a catch block.Uncomment the throw new Exception line in

Example In this example we have written alert as adddlert to deliberately produce an error:

script try { adddlert("Welcome guest!");}catch(err) { document.getElementById("demo").innerHTML = err.message;} Try it Yourself » This documentation is archived and is not being maintained. You’ll be auto redirected in 1 second. Errors detected during execution are called exceptions and are not unconditionally fatal: you will soon learn how to handle them in Python programs.

Rerun the transaction.]! An error that ordinarily ends a transaction outside a TRY block causes a transaction to enter an uncommittable state when the error occurs inside a TRY block. The string printed as the exception type is the name of the built-in exception that occurred. try: ...

print 'My exception occurred, value:', e.value ... If you're wondering what the exception code can be used for, read on below.

Let's say each time your application isn't able to connect to the database, you can You can use this identifier to get information about the exception that was thrown.